Well I have made some changes, these are:

.- added an splash screen with the java, jpct, lwjgl, opengl and openal logo
.- redefined the changes publisher for notifing clients when a new player is on or off, etc.
.- Added the sound infrastructure
.- Added the chat infrastructure
.- fixed several bugs
.- improved some stupid things (I began the game hwhen I began programming, so there are many stupid code difficult to remove)
.- fixed problems when coloring special parts for diferent players
.- fixed the problem that sometimes the client cant began plating and some clients coulnt see others
.- some other things

I am still working from time to time but there still a lot of work before having a first release of my game.
